Compartilhar via


Classe CMenuTearOffManager

Gerencia menus de rasgo - fora. Um menu de rasgo - fora é um menu na barra de menus. O usuário pode remover um menu de rasgo - fora da barra de menus, causando o menu de rasgo - fora ao flutuante.

class CMenuTearOffManager : public CObject

Membros

Construtores public

Nome

Descrição

CMenuTearOffManager::CMenuTearOffManager

Constrói um objeto de CMenuTearOffManager .

Métodos públicos

Nome

Descrição

CMenuTearOffManager::Build

 

CMenuTearOffManager::GetRegPath

 

CMenuTearOffManager::Initialize

Inicializa um objeto de CMenuTearOffManager .

CMenuTearOffManager::IsDynamicID

 

CMenuTearOffManager::Parse

 

CMenuTearOffManager::Reset

 

CMenuTearOffManager::SetInUse

 

CMenuTearOffManager::SetupTearOffMenus

 

Comentários

Para usar menus de rasgo - fora do seu aplicativo, você deve ter um objeto de CMenuTearOffManager . Em a maioria dos casos, não criará ou não inicializará um objeto de CMenuTearOffManager diretamente. Isso é tratado para você quando você chama a função de CWinAppEx::EnableTearOffMenus .

Exemplo

O exemplo a seguir demonstra como construir e inicializar um objeto de CMenuTearOffManager chamando o método de CWinAppEX::EnableTearOffMenus . Este trecho de código é parte de Exemplo de preenchimento da palavra.

   // The EnableTearOffMenus method is inherited from the CWinAppEx class.
    EnableTearOffMenus (NULL, ID_FREE_TEAROFF1, ID_FREE_TEAROFF2);

Hierarquia de herança

CObject

   CMenuTearOffManager

Requisitos

Cabeçalho: afxmenutearoffmanager.h

Consulte também

Referência

Gráfico da hierarquia

Classe CWinAppEx

Outros recursos

Classes MFC